Celebrating 5th Miri International Jazz Festival: May14-15
Written by goM   
Sunday, 18 April 2010 02:18

Miri International Jazz Festival 2010The Miri International Jazz Festival (MIJF) 2010 promised to deliver another exciting event with wide repertoire of jazz genre already lined up to provide the entertainment.

This jazz festival which has been enjoying a steady growth in popularity will be held at the Pavilion of Parkcity Everly Hotel in Miri from May 14 and 15, 2010.

Organised by the Sarawak Tourism Board (STB), the festival, entering into its 5th year, will see performances from jazz bands from various countries and their genre of jazz includes blues, fusion, world, smooth and Latino beat.

The bands that will heat up the MIJF stage are James Cotton Blues Band (USA), Amina Figarova Sextet (Holland), Ricardo Herz (Brazil), Mellow Motif (Thailand), Michael Shrieve’s Spellbinder (USA), SimakDialog (Indonesia), Norbert Susemihl’s New Orleans All Stars (Denmark/Germany/USA) and Jeremy Tordjman (Switzerland).


Promised to be another signature event for Sarawak’s  tourism calendar, MIJF 2010 is expected to exude similar vibe as in the previous festivals.

Sarawak Tourism Board’s Chief Executive Officer, Dato Rashid Khan said STB was targeting at attracting a crowd of 8,000 to the festival this year.

“We are very optimistic in achieving this target in view of the overwhelming respond towards MIJF 2009 which saw a crowd of about 6,000 attending the festival during the two nights”, he enthused.

Besides the good music and company, guests can also enjoy the wide variety of food and beverages as there will be various stalls set up in and around the festival venue.
 
MIJF is supported by the Ministry of Tourism Malaysia, Ministry of Tourism and Heritage, Sarawak, and Tourism Malaysia.
